Vapor barrier installation services involve placing a specialized membrane beneath floors, in crawl spaces, or within basements to prevent moisture from penetrating building structures. These barriers are typically made from plastic or other durable materials designed to resist water vapor transmission. The installation process usually includes preparing the area, laying out the vapor barrier material smoothly, and securing it properly to ensure it remains effective over time. Proper installation is essential to maximize the barrier’s ability to control moisture and protect the property from related issues.

One of the primary problems vapor barriers help address is excess moisture buildup within a building's foundation or crawl space. When moisture accumulates, it can lead to a range of issues such as mold growth, wood rot, and increased humidity levels inside the property. These problems not only compromise the structural integrity of the building but can also impact indoor air quality. Vapor barriers act as a preventative measure, reducing the risk of these moisture-related problems by creating a barrier that limits the transfer of water vapor from the ground or surrounding environment into the interior spaces.

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.25 to $0.75 per square foot, depending on quality and type. For a standard basement, material expenses might be around $200 to $600.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s usually fall between $1.00 and $2.50 per square foot. For a 1,000-square-foot area, total labor charges could range from $1,000 to $2,500.

Project Size - Larger areas generally increase overall costs, with some projects reaching $3,000 or more for extensive vapor barrier installation. Smaller projects may cost less, often under $1,000.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include surface preparation or repairs, adding $200 to $500 to the total cost. These factors can influence the final price depending on the project's sc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through floors, walls, or ceilings, helping to control humidity levels indoors.

Where should vapor barriers be installed? Vapor barriers are typically installed in areas like basements, crawl spaces, or underneath concrete slabs to reduce moisture intrusion.

What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ene sheets, foil-backed membranes, and other moisture-resistant films.
